Transaction d8316e239291856014025118bd5fde6194ebccecf180094dbb2468bd1ec8f842
1 Input
1 Output
-
d8316e239291856014025118bd5fde6194ebccecf180094dbb2468bd1ec8f842:0
- value
- 26620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 956feb1c21fdcee0e8cd581f7ae5668ff34ba4f2 OP_EQUAL
- address
- 3FKAgMS78iA6nKKB4zUwiw76Ctn9FWTQ2Q